Output 5efadce62e29c8992a7581ec4691aea0037a6f777e6ffbff00a64fcbb925918e:2

value
935675
script pubkey
OP_0 OP_PUSHBYTES_20 cf576bb461c02e9b8a7e13df5a831b9e83a52aff
address
tb1qeatkhdrpcqhfhzn7z0044qcmn6p622hlllnxku
transaction
5efadce62e29c8992a7581ec4691aea0037a6f777e6ffbff00a64fcbb925918e
confirmations
100898
spent
true